Hot fix remove cup not showing button
This commit is contained in:
parent
8206f95131
commit
0acd376e6c
2 changed files with 69 additions and 199 deletions
|
|
@ -40,8 +40,6 @@
|
||||||
<Timeout> 1000 </Timeout>
|
<Timeout> 1000 </Timeout>
|
||||||
<EventTimeout>
|
<EventTimeout>
|
||||||
|
|
||||||
|
|
||||||
|
|
||||||
Var Timeout = Timeout + 1
|
Var Timeout = Timeout + 1
|
||||||
|
|
||||||
DEBUGVAR Timeout
|
DEBUGVAR Timeout
|
||||||
|
|
@ -49,99 +47,44 @@
|
||||||
DEBUGVAR NextOrder
|
DEBUGVAR NextOrder
|
||||||
DEBUGVAR HaveCup
|
DEBUGVAR HaveCup
|
||||||
|
|
||||||
If Door_Open_flagBlink = 0 Then
|
|
||||||
Var Door_Open_flagBlink = 1
|
|
||||||
Var Door_Open_State="Enable"
|
|
||||||
Else
|
|
||||||
Var Door_Open_flagBlink = 0
|
|
||||||
Var Door_Open_State="Invisible"
|
|
||||||
EndIf
|
|
||||||
|
|
||||||
If HaveCup = "true" Then
|
|
||||||
DEBUGVAR CheckCupStateDoorCupClose
|
|
||||||
|
|
||||||
If CheckCupStateDoorCupClose = "" Then
|
|
||||||
Var buttonRemoveCup = "Enable"
|
|
||||||
EndIf
|
|
||||||
|
|
||||||
If CheckCupStateDoorCupClose = "done" Then
|
|
||||||
Var buttonRemoveCup = "Enable"
|
|
||||||
EndIf
|
|
||||||
|
|
||||||
If CheckCupStateDoorCupClose = "reset" Then
|
|
||||||
|
|
||||||
If CheckCupStateDoorCupCloseCnt = 0 Then
|
|
||||||
Var CheckCupStateDoorCupClose = ""
|
|
||||||
Else
|
|
||||||
Var CheckCupStateDoorCupCloseCnt = CheckCupStateDoorCupCloseCnt - 1
|
|
||||||
|
|
||||||
EndIf
|
|
||||||
EndIf
|
|
||||||
Else
|
|
||||||
If buttonRemoveCup = "Enable" Then
|
|
||||||
Var buttonRemoveCup = "Invisible"
|
|
||||||
EndIf
|
|
||||||
EndIf
|
|
||||||
|
|
||||||
If buttonRemoveCup = "Invisible" Then
|
|
||||||
Var Door_Open_State = "Invisible"
|
|
||||||
EndIf
|
|
||||||
|
|
||||||
DEBUGVAR buttonRemoveCup
|
DEBUGVAR buttonRemoveCup
|
||||||
|
DEBUGVAR NextOrder
|
||||||
DEBUGVAR Door_Open_State
|
DEBUGVAR Door_Open_State
|
||||||
|
|
||||||
If MachineStage = "remove-cup" Then
|
|
||||||
|
|
||||||
Else
|
If NextOrder = "true" Then
|
||||||
If NextOrder = "true" Then
|
Var NextOrder = "false"
|
||||||
Var NextOrder = "false"
|
|
||||||
|
|
||||||
TransferVar "next" "curr"
|
TransferVar "next" "curr"
|
||||||
Var Seeker = "curr"
|
Var Seeker = "curr"
|
||||||
|
|
||||||
SAVELOG "Remove cup drink fail "
|
SAVELOG "Have Cup 2"
|
||||||
|
|
||||||
Open "ROOT/taobin_project/xml/page_thankyouConti.xml"
|
Open "ROOT/taobin_project/xml/page_thankyouConti.xml"
|
||||||
Else
|
Else
|
||||||
Open "ROOT/taobin_project/xml/page_back_to_main.xml"
|
Open "ROOT/taobin_project/xml/page_back_to_main.xml"
|
||||||
EndIf
|
EndIf
|
||||||
EndIf
|
|
||||||
|
|
||||||
; must remove cup.
|
|
||||||
If HaveCup = "true" Then
|
|
||||||
|
|
||||||
Else
|
|
||||||
If NextOrder = "true" Then
|
|
||||||
Var NextOrder = "false"
|
|
||||||
|
|
||||||
TransferVar "next" "curr"
|
|
||||||
Var Seeker = "curr"
|
|
||||||
|
|
||||||
SAVELOG "Have Cup"
|
|
||||||
|
|
||||||
Open "ROOT/taobin_project/xml/page_thankyouConti.xml"
|
|
||||||
Else
|
|
||||||
Open "ROOT/taobin_project/xml/page_back_to_main.xml"
|
|
||||||
EndIf
|
|
||||||
EndIf
|
|
||||||
|
|
||||||
|
|
||||||
If Timeout > 240 Then
|
|
||||||
If NextOrder = "true" Then
|
|
||||||
SAVELOG "TIME OUT 240"
|
|
||||||
Var NextOrder = "false"
|
|
||||||
|
|
||||||
TransferVar "next" "curr"
|
If Timeout > 120 Then
|
||||||
Var Seeker = "curr"
|
If NextOrder = "true" Then
|
||||||
|
SAVELOG "TIME OUT 240"
|
||||||
|
Var NextOrder = "false"
|
||||||
|
|
||||||
Open "ROOT/taobin_project/xml/page_thankyouConti.xml"
|
TransferVar "next" "curr"
|
||||||
Else
|
Var Seeker = "curr"
|
||||||
Open "ROOT/taobin_project/xml/page_back_to_main.xml"
|
|
||||||
EndIf
|
Open "ROOT/taobin_project/xml/page_thankyouConti.xml"
|
||||||
EndIf
|
Else
|
||||||
|
Open "ROOT/taobin_project/xml/page_back_to_main.xml"
|
||||||
|
EndIf
|
||||||
|
EndIf
|
||||||
|
|
||||||
Refresh
|
Refresh
|
||||||
TimerReset
|
TimerReset
|
||||||
|
|
||||||
|
|
||||||
</EventTimeout>
|
</EventTimeout>
|
||||||
|
|
|
||||||
|
|
@ -6,50 +6,32 @@
|
||||||
<Volume> SoundVolume </Volume>
|
<Volume> SoundVolume </Volume>
|
||||||
|
|
||||||
<EventOpen>
|
<EventOpen>
|
||||||
; On open
|
; On open
|
||||||
|
|
||||||
|
|
||||||
|
|
||||||
If show_eng = "true" Then
|
|
||||||
Var DirImage = "ROOT/taobin_project/image/collectiing_en/"
|
|
||||||
|
|
||||||
Else
|
|
||||||
Var DirImage = "ROOT/taobin_project/image/collectiing/"
|
|
||||||
EndIf
|
|
||||||
|
|
||||||
If LanguageShow = "MYANMAR" Then
|
If show_eng = "true" Then
|
||||||
Var DirImage = "ROOT/taobin_project/image/collectiing_mmr/"
|
Var DirImage = "ROOT/taobin_project/image/collectiing_en/"
|
||||||
EndIf
|
|
||||||
|
|
||||||
|
Else
|
||||||
Var Timeout = 0
|
Var DirImage = "ROOT/taobin_project/image/collectiing/"
|
||||||
|
EndIf
|
||||||
|
|
||||||
|
If LanguageShow = "MYANMAR" Then
|
||||||
|
Var DirImage = "ROOT/taobin_project/image/collectiing_mmr/"
|
||||||
|
EndIf
|
||||||
|
|
||||||
|
|
||||||
|
Var Timeout = 0
|
||||||
|
|
||||||
Var Door_Open_State="Invisible"
|
Var Door_Open_State="Invisible"
|
||||||
Var Door_Open_flagBlink = 0
|
Var Door_Open_flagBlink = 0
|
||||||
|
|
||||||
|
|
||||||
|
|
||||||
If HaveCup = "true" Then
|
|
||||||
|
|
||||||
If CheckCupStateDoorCupClose = "" Then
|
|
||||||
Var buttonRemoveCup = "Enable"
|
|
||||||
EndIf
|
|
||||||
|
|
||||||
If CheckCupStateDoorCupClose = "done" Then
|
|
||||||
Var buttonRemoveCup = "Enable"
|
|
||||||
EndIf
|
|
||||||
Else
|
|
||||||
If buttonRemoveCup = "Enable" Then
|
|
||||||
Var buttonRemoveCup = "Invisible"
|
|
||||||
EndIf
|
|
||||||
EndIf
|
|
||||||
|
|
||||||
Var CheckCupStateDoorCupCloseCnt = 15
|
|
||||||
</EventOpen>
|
</EventOpen>
|
||||||
<Timeout> 1000 </Timeout>
|
<Timeout> 1000 </Timeout>
|
||||||
<EventTimeout>
|
<EventTimeout>
|
||||||
|
|
||||||
|
|
||||||
|
|
||||||
Var Timeout = Timeout + 1
|
Var Timeout = Timeout + 1
|
||||||
|
|
||||||
|
|
@ -58,102 +40,47 @@
|
||||||
DEBUGVAR NextOrder
|
DEBUGVAR NextOrder
|
||||||
DEBUGVAR HaveCup
|
DEBUGVAR HaveCup
|
||||||
|
|
||||||
If Door_Open_flagBlink = 0 Then
|
|
||||||
Var Door_Open_flagBlink = 1
|
|
||||||
Var Door_Open_State="Enable"
|
|
||||||
Else
|
|
||||||
Var Door_Open_flagBlink = 0
|
|
||||||
Var Door_Open_State="Invisible"
|
|
||||||
EndIf
|
|
||||||
|
|
||||||
If HaveCup = "true" Then
|
|
||||||
DEBUGVAR CheckCupStateDoorCupClose
|
|
||||||
|
|
||||||
If CheckCupStateDoorCupClose = "" Then
|
|
||||||
Var buttonRemoveCup = "Enable"
|
|
||||||
EndIf
|
|
||||||
|
|
||||||
If CheckCupStateDoorCupClose = "done" Then
|
|
||||||
Var buttonRemoveCup = "Enable"
|
|
||||||
EndIf
|
|
||||||
|
|
||||||
If CheckCupStateDoorCupClose = "reset" Then
|
|
||||||
|
|
||||||
If CheckCupStateDoorCupCloseCnt = 0 Then
|
|
||||||
Var CheckCupStateDoorCupClose = ""
|
|
||||||
Else
|
|
||||||
Var CheckCupStateDoorCupCloseCnt = CheckCupStateDoorCupCloseCnt - 1
|
|
||||||
|
|
||||||
EndIf
|
|
||||||
EndIf
|
|
||||||
Else
|
|
||||||
If buttonRemoveCup = "Enable" Then
|
|
||||||
Var buttonRemoveCup = "Invisible"
|
|
||||||
EndIf
|
|
||||||
EndIf
|
|
||||||
|
|
||||||
If buttonRemoveCup = "Invisible" Then
|
|
||||||
Var Door_Open_State = "Invisible"
|
|
||||||
EndIf
|
|
||||||
|
|
||||||
DEBUGVAR buttonRemoveCup
|
DEBUGVAR buttonRemoveCup
|
||||||
|
DEBUGVAR NextOrder
|
||||||
DEBUGVAR Door_Open_State
|
DEBUGVAR Door_Open_State
|
||||||
|
|
||||||
If MachineStage = "remove-cup" Then
|
|
||||||
|
|
||||||
Else
|
|
||||||
If NextOrder = "true" Then
|
|
||||||
Var NextOrder = "false"
|
|
||||||
|
|
||||||
TransferVar "next" "curr"
|
If NextOrder = "true" Then
|
||||||
Var Seeker = "curr"
|
Var NextOrder = "false"
|
||||||
|
|
||||||
SAVELOG "Remove cup drink fail "
|
TransferVar "next" "curr"
|
||||||
|
Var Seeker = "curr"
|
||||||
Open "ROOT/taobin_project/xml/page_thankyouConti.xml"
|
|
||||||
Else
|
|
||||||
Open "ROOT/taobin_project/xml/page_back_to_main.xml"
|
|
||||||
EndIf
|
|
||||||
EndIf
|
|
||||||
|
|
||||||
; must remove cup.
|
SAVELOG "Have Cup 2"
|
||||||
If HaveCup = "true" Then
|
|
||||||
|
|
||||||
Else
|
|
||||||
If NextOrder = "true" Then
|
|
||||||
Var NextOrder = "false"
|
|
||||||
|
|
||||||
TransferVar "next" "curr"
|
Open "ROOT/taobin_project/xml/page_thankyouConti.xml"
|
||||||
Var Seeker = "curr"
|
Else
|
||||||
|
Open "ROOT/taobin_project/xml/page_back_to_main.xml"
|
||||||
|
EndIf
|
||||||
|
|
||||||
SAVELOG "Have Cup"
|
|
||||||
|
|
||||||
Open "ROOT/taobin_project/xml/page_thankyouConti.xml"
|
|
||||||
Else
|
|
||||||
Open "ROOT/taobin_project/xml/page_back_to_main.xml"
|
|
||||||
EndIf
|
|
||||||
EndIf
|
|
||||||
|
|
||||||
|
|
||||||
If Timeout > 240 Then
|
|
||||||
If NextOrder = "true" Then
|
|
||||||
SAVELOG "TIME OUT 240"
|
|
||||||
Var NextOrder = "false"
|
|
||||||
|
|
||||||
TransferVar "next" "curr"
|
If Timeout > 120 Then
|
||||||
Var Seeker = "curr"
|
If NextOrder = "true" Then
|
||||||
|
SAVELOG "TIME OUT 240"
|
||||||
Open "ROOT/taobin_project/xml/page_thankyouConti.xml"
|
Var NextOrder = "false"
|
||||||
Else
|
|
||||||
Open "ROOT/taobin_project/xml/page_back_to_main.xml"
|
TransferVar "next" "curr"
|
||||||
EndIf
|
Var Seeker = "curr"
|
||||||
EndIf
|
|
||||||
|
Open "ROOT/taobin_project/xml/page_thankyouConti.xml"
|
||||||
|
Else
|
||||||
|
Open "ROOT/taobin_project/xml/page_back_to_main.xml"
|
||||||
|
EndIf
|
||||||
|
EndIf
|
||||||
|
|
||||||
Refresh
|
Refresh
|
||||||
TimerReset
|
TimerReset
|
||||||
|
|
||||||
|
|
||||||
</EventTimeout>
|
|
||||||
|
</EventTimeout>
|
||||||
|
|
||||||
|
|
||||||
|
|
||||||
|
|
@ -189,13 +116,13 @@
|
||||||
<Sound> "/mnt/sdcard/coffeevending/wav/click.wav" </Sound>
|
<Sound> "/mnt/sdcard/coffeevending/wav/click.wav" </Sound>
|
||||||
<Volume> SoundVolume </Volume>
|
<Volume> SoundVolume </Volume>
|
||||||
<State>buttonRemoveCup</State>
|
<State>buttonRemoveCup</State>
|
||||||
<EventClick>
|
<EventClick>
|
||||||
|
|
||||||
Machine RemoveCup
|
Machine RemoveCup
|
||||||
Var buttonRemoveCup = "Invisible"
|
Var buttonRemoveCup = "Invisible"
|
||||||
Var CheckCupStateDoorCupClose = "reset"
|
Var CheckCupStateDoorCupClose = "reset"
|
||||||
Var CheckCupStateDoorCupCloseCnt = 15
|
Var CheckCupStateDoorCupCloseCnt = 15
|
||||||
|
|
||||||
</EventClick>
|
</EventClick>
|
||||||
</Button>
|
</Button>
|
||||||
|
|
||||||
|
|
@ -207,8 +134,8 @@
|
||||||
<FilenamePress> Var( DirImage + "/bp_door_open.png" )</FilenamePress>
|
<FilenamePress> Var( DirImage + "/bp_door_open.png" )</FilenamePress>
|
||||||
<Sound> "/mnt/sdcard/coffeevending/wav/click.wav" </Sound>
|
<Sound> "/mnt/sdcard/coffeevending/wav/click.wav" </Sound>
|
||||||
<Volume> SoundVolume </Volume>
|
<Volume> SoundVolume </Volume>
|
||||||
<EventClick>
|
<EventClick>
|
||||||
Machine RemoveCup
|
Machine RemoveCup
|
||||||
Var buttonRemoveCup = "Invisible"
|
Var buttonRemoveCup = "Invisible"
|
||||||
Var CheckCupStateDoorCupClose = "reset"
|
Var CheckCupStateDoorCupClose = "reset"
|
||||||
Var CheckCupStateDoorCupCloseCnt = 15
|
Var CheckCupStateDoorCupCloseCnt = 15
|
||||||
|
|
|
||||||
Loading…
Add table
Add a link
Reference in a new issue